    Bridesmaid and family. The typical Indian Hindu marriage ceremony does not usually have the concept of bridesmaids. But in many Hindu weddings, women in the family often prefer to wear either a sari, lahenga, Anarkali Salwar Suit or simple shalwar kameez.

    Bridesmaids are members of the bride's party at some Western traditional wedding ceremonies. A bridesmaid is typically a young woman and often the bride 's close friend or relative. She attends to the bride on the day of a wedding or marriage ceremony.
